Description
Versatile incremental encoder delivers reliable speed measurement for fundamental automation processes, ensuring consistent system performance and increased operational efficiency.
Compact flange design (Ø200 mm outer diameter, 9 mm flange thickness, 165 mm BCD) enables seamless integration into both new and existing drive systems, saving time and minimizing engineering efforts.
Shaft diameter of 19 mm provides compatibility with a wide range of motor shafts, particularly suitable for IEC 80B5 motors, making it ideal for industrial motors and machinery.
Aluminium housing ensures lightweight construction while maintaining high mechanical strength and excellent resistance to harsh industrial environments.
High ingress protection rating, with IP55/IP67 classification, guarantees robust defense against dust, water jets, and temporary submersion, making the device suitable for demanding working conditions.
16 pulses per revolution (PPR) output per channel via A 90° B HTL provides essential feedback for core motion control, speed measurement, and monitoring in conveyors, automated material handling, and standard robotic applications.
Wide input voltage range (5-24VDC) ensures compatibility with a broad spectrum of control systems and PLCs, facilitating straightforward implementation.
Equipped with a 2-meter pre-fitted cable for quick installation and flexible system configuration, reducing setup time on-site.
MIG Basic series is perfect for standard automated processes, including packaging equipment, basic conveyor lines, and general machine automation where reliable speed feedback is crucial.For higher resolution requirements, the MIG Nova+ series offers advanced signal stability for precise regulation. For applications demanding absolute positioning even after power loss, the MIG AST absolute encoders are available.
